Description
English: Offered for sale by Abbott and Holder in June 2020, when it was described as "‘‘Star’ on which the body was brought up’. Pencil. Inscribed. Provenance: Album of Charles Keene drawings collected by Lord Clark (Sir Kenneth Clark). 3.5x6.75 inches.".
Date before 1892
